How far people went at school, the qualifications they hold and what they studied.
Far fewer people have finished high school in Burracoppin than in most other areas, with only 41.2% completing Year 12. This gap is seen across the board, as university degrees are also much less common here than in the rest of the state.
Highest year of school completed.
Only 41.2% of residents finished Year 12, which is far below the national figure of 58.8%. Other common highest levels of schooling include Year 10 at 18.8% and Year 11 at 14.1%.

Post-school qualifications and degrees.
Adults with a bachelor degree or higher make up 11.7% of the population, far below the Western Australian figure of 23.8%. The most common qualification is a Certificate III or IV, held by 29.4% of people.

What people studied.
The most common fields of qualification are management and commerce at 17.6%, followed by health at 13.7% and agriculture and environment at 9.8%.
